WebThe Gemstone Jasper. Jasper is an opaque variety of Chalcedony, and is usually associated with brown, yellow, or reddish colors, but may be used to describe other opaque colors of Chalcedony such as dark or mottled green, orange, and black. WebIn general, metamorphic rocks are usually off-white or dull shades of gray, black, or brown.
